A long-form interview with William Schalda Jr., who played in more than one precursor to The Budos Band, and who has since played with Charles Bradley, with NY garage rock legends The Realistics, with his family band The Sha La Das, and while wearing many hats for his solo project Billy Swivs. Will tells us funny stories from growing up in Staten Island, during which time he suffered tuba in the high school marching band.
